Transaction 7c63936754308e89e2a6864e9ed166d58918bf68df34ea30b53ef38d8316a12c
1 Input
1 Output
-
7c63936754308e89e2a6864e9ed166d58918bf68df34ea30b53ef38d8316a12c:0
- value
- 32392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fbfa3018cb540b46e85c4c3701941fb0f4e107d OP_EQUAL
- address
- 3LdVNQZD44KeX2mufhiyCK38H4t8UDksNz